Emergency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small sink overflow on tile floor Yes No You can clean up the spill and dry the floor yourself, but if the water seeps into the walls or subfloor, it’s best to call a pro to prevent further damage.
Flooded basement with standing water No Yes Standing water in your basement can cause significant damage and health hazards. Call a pro to extract the water, dry the area, and prevent mold growth.
Wet drywall behind cabinets No Yes Hidden water damage behind drywall can cause costly repairs down the line. Call a pro to detect and remove the moisture, ensuring your property remains safe and secure.
Basement flood with sewage backup No Yes Sewage backup in your basement needs specialized equipment and techniques to clean and disinfect the area. Call a pro to handle this situation safely and effectively.
Water damage from burst pipe No Yes Burst pipes can cause significant damage and health hazards. Call a pro to extract the water, dry the area, and prevent further damage.
Mold growth in attic or crawl space No Yes Mold growth in your attic or crawl space needs specialized equipment and techniques to remove and prevent future growth. Call a pro to handle this situation safely and effectively.

With emergency damage restoration, it’s always best to err on the side of caution. If you’re unsure about the severity of the damage or the best course of action, call a pro to assess the situation and provide a plan for recovery.

Emergency Damage Restoration Cost in the 75442 Area

The cost of emergency damage restoration in the 75442 area can vary greatly dep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the local conditions. As a general estimate, you can expect to pay between $500 and $2,500 for a typical emergency damage restoration service. But, this price range can fluctuate based on the specific situation, and we recommend scheduling an on-site assessment to get a more accurate estimate.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Water Extraction $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of water damage, and equipment required
Structural Drying Process $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of drying equipment required, and labor costs
Moisture Detection and Monitoring $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ment required, and labor costs
Sewage Cleanup $1,500 – $6,000 Size of affected area, type of sewage, and equipment required
Basement Flood Recovery $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, type of flooding, and equipment required
Mold Removal from Drywall $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of mold, and equipment required

Keep in mind that these estimates are rough and can vary based on the specific situation. We recommend scheduling an on-site assessment to get a more accurate estimate and to ensure that you receive the best possible service for your emergency damage restoration needs.
